Jandy · JXi 260 260,000 BTU Pool Heater with High Efficiency and Digital Temperature Control
The exhaust stack temperature sensor has tripped indicating exhaust gases are too hot — the heat exchanger is not transferring heat efficiently to the water; primary cause is inadequate water flow (same as HL — dirty filter, low pump speed, closed valves); can also indicate calcium scale buildup inside the heat exchanger tubes reducing heat transfer, or a partially blocked flue causing heat to back up; clean the pool filter, check water flow, and descale the heat exchanger if necessary
Error SFS on the Jandy JXi 260 260,000 BTU Pool Heater with High Efficiency and Digital Temperature Control means: Stack Flue Sensor Trip.
